KARINJESHWARA TEMPLE
It is situated in the town of Karinja, in the Dakshin Kannada district, This temple is situated in the Bantwal taluka and is atop a hill in the Karinja village.
The Sri Karinjeshwara temple lies 14 kilometres away from Bantwal and 35 kilometres away from Mangalore. The temple is well connected by roads. The temple is just two kilometres away from Vegga on the Mangalore-Belthangady route.
The temple is split into two parts. Halfway up the mountain sits the temple of Parvathi. At the top of the mountain is the temple of Shiva.
The Surya Sadashiva Temple is dedicated to Lord Shiva and his consort Goddess Parvati. A devotee will have to climb ( only by foot ) as many as 555 steps in order to reach the Sri Karinjeshwara temple.
